What to Know About Build Quality and Materials When Choosing a Home Counter Top Water Dispenser

When selecting a home counter top water dispenser, most buyers focus on features like cooling speed, design, or ease of use—but often overlook one of the most critical aspects: materials and build quality. As a manufacturer with years of experience in hydration appliances, we’ve seen how structural integrity and material choice directly impact the dispenser’s performance, durability, and user safety over time. A sleek exterior may look good on your kitchen counter, but what’s inside the unit—and how it’s built—determines its true long-term value.

Start with the outer shell. High-quality ABS plastic is commonly used for a reason: it’s heat-resistant, durable, and resists cracking under frequent handling. Cheaper alternatives may reduce costs upfront but often show signs of wear, discoloration, or brittleness with extended use, especially in warm or humid climates. For a more premium finish, some counter top water dispensers incorporate stainless steel panels or trim, which not only enhance visual appeal but also improve resistance to dents and stains—a great option for households where style and substance both matter.

The inner components, particularly those that come into contact with water, deserve close attention. BPA-free reservoirs are essential in any modern water dispenser to prevent harmful chemicals from leaching into drinking water. Some dispensers also use food-grade stainless steel for internal tanks, which is more hygienic and less prone to bacterial growth than plastic. From a manufacturer's perspective, investing in these materials reflects a commitment to safety and product longevity—two attributes discerning users now expect as standard.

Another overlooked factor is the dispenser’s structural design and weight distribution. A well-balanced unit reduces vibration and prevents tipping, especially important in households with children or pets. Thicker internal tubing and reinforced joints also play a role in long-term reliability, ensuring the dispenser maintains a consistent flow rate without leaks or sudden pressure loss. These may seem like minor engineering details, but they become crucial in real-world daily use.

Thermal insulation is another area where material quality makes a measurable difference. Better insulation materials—such as polyurethane foam used between internal chambers—help maintain stable water temperatures with less energy consumption. This not only improves the efficiency of the home counter top water dispenser but also lowers electricity costs over time, making it a smarter long-term purchase.
